Redefining the developer profile

Traditional career paths in tech often require computer science degrees and years of extensive training. However, SALT – School of Applied Technology takes a different approach, actively seeking individuals with prior work experience who thrive in team environments and enjoy coding in their free time. SALT is designed for those who dream of leveraging their valuable professional experience from other industries to build a new career as full-stack developers. This approach has contributed to greater gender diversity within tech, with nearly half of participants being women.

The advantage of diverse perspectives

Non-traditional developers bring unique advantages to tech teams. An architect’s eye for design naturally translates to user interface development, while an economist’s analytical skills prove invaluable in data-driven programming. These diverse perspectives foster innovation and create more inclusive technology solutions that better serve varied user needs. In fact, companies may find that a full-stack developer with a non-traditional background brings even more value than a traditional developer, as they approach problems with fresh perspectives and a broader range of skills, making them adaptable and well-suited for dynamic, interdisciplinary roles.

Creating sustainable career transitions

The success of this approach is evident in the outcomes. When graduates complete their training through SALT’s coding boot camp, they enter a paid consultancy role where they can apply their newly acquired technical skills while leveraging their previous professional experience. This combination of fresh technical knowledge and established professional competencies results in developers who bring unique value to technology projects.
